FHA Loans – FHA 2/1 Buy-Down Loan Program – FHA 2/1 Buy-Down Loan Program. FHA Buy-down loans are simply a 30 or 15 year fixed rate mortgages where you (or the seller) have prepaid interest rate buy-down fee’s to obtain a 1% or 2% lower interest rate for the first 1 or 2 years.

What is a conventional fixed-rate mortgage? A "fixed-rate" mortgage comes with an interest rate that won’t change for the life of your home loan.A "conventional" (conforming) mortgage is a loan that conforms to established guidelines for the size of the loan and your financial situation.
